Y’a D’la Joie!
Fragrance notes
Character
Y’a D’la Joie! opens with a bright mix of pear, black currant and mandarin orange that feels immediate and cheerful. The fruit is sweet but not heavy, and the citrus keeps the opening from leaning too far into candy. Sugar cane and peach arrive in the heart alongside orange blossom, adding a soft floral layer that rounds out the sharp edges of the fruit. Vanilla, musk, amber, sandalwood and patchouli form a base that is warm and powdery without becoming dark or overwhelming. The musk and amber give it a gentle skin-like softness, while sandalwood and patchouli add just enough wood and earth to keep the vanilla from dominating completely.
The overall impression is sweet, fruity and vanilla-led, with a musky and powdery finish that stays light on the skin. It suits a bright morning walk, a sunny afternoon outdoors or a casual daytime gathering where something friendly and approachable is welcome. The fruit and sugar cane make it feel playful rather than formal, and the floral heart prevents it from reading as a pure gourmand. The limitation here is the sugar cane and peach, which push the sweetness to a point that can feel a bit one-dimensional if you prefer drier, more restrained compositions.
